Barings Goes Live With "Enhanced" App

Eliane Chavagnon

27 September 2012

Baring Asset Management has launched an updated app, giving retail and professional investors the latest fund prices and information.

The app - compatible with Apple, Android and BlackBerry devices - also provides investment views and fund manager interviews. Additionally, users can select their location and language, while using the customised function to bring up the funds in which they are interested and to select from a range of currency options.

Barings launched a BlackBerry-friendly version of its fund prices app in June. The app allows investors to track Barings’ fund prices, covering a range of Asia Pacific, EMEA, fixed income, global emerging markets, European and multi-asset vehicles. It also permits users to filter funds by geographical and currency preferences, and provides information on individual funds, including charges and minimum investment requirements.
